Source: Virginia Department of Education, Office of Child Care Licensing- Violation
8VAC20-780-130-A · The center shall obtain documentation that each child has received the immunizations required by the State Board of Health before the child can attend the center.
A child, who had been attending less than a week, did not have documentation of an immunization record on file.
- Violation
22.1-289.011-F · The license and any other documents required by the Superintendent shall be posted in a conspicuous place on the licensed premises.
The inspection and violation notice from the inspection completed on 1/22/26 was not posted.
- Violation
22.1-289.035-B-4 · The center is required to obtain background checks from any state in which the individual has resided in the preceding five years.
Staff #4, whose been living in another state, did not have documentation of requesting a central registry check from that state.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-40-E · The operational responsibilities of the licensee shall include ensuring that the center's activities, services, and facilities are maintained in compliance with the center's own policies and procedures that are required by these standards. The Face-to-Name (N2F) Transition Sheet did not have complete documentation of the arrival and/or departure of children and staff in the classroom#1 and #2. On 7/16/25, Class #1 did not document the arrival time of four children as it occurred and Staff # 5 and #6 did not document their arrival to the classroom. At the time of transition from classroom #1, Staff #5 did not document the departure of nine children to classroom #2.
- Violation
22.1-289.035-B-4 · Based on record review, the child day center failed to obtain a copy of the results of a sex offender registry check from any state in which the individual has resided in the preceding five years.
Evidence: 1. The record for Staff #3 (DOH 3/25/24) did not have documentation of an out-of-state sex offender registry results at the time of the inspection.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-160-A · Based on record review, the documentation of a negative tuberculosis (TB) screening was not submitted at the time of employment and prior to coming into contact with children.
Evidence: 1. The date of hire for Staff #2 was 07/24/23 and the documentation for a negative TB screening was dated 09/18/23. Repeat violation: Previous violation 01/03/23.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-280-B · Based on observation, hazardous substances such as cleaning materials were not kept in a locked place using a safe locking method that prevents access by children.
Evidence: 1. The twos classroom had cleaning materials (bleach, glass cleaner, liquid soap) inside an unlocked cabinet that was located under the sink.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-130-A · Based on record review, the center did not obtain documentation that each child has received the immunizations required before the child can attend the center.
Evidence: 1.Child #1 started on 9/9/22 and immunization is dated 9/30/22.
